Subject: Swapping out the homegrown queue

Team — the Pinwheel job queue is being replaced with Relayforge in this release. Old workers drain tonight; new consumers are already shadowing. Review scope: the migration shim and retry semantics only. Flag anything odd by Thursday. The candidate build is identified below.

pipeline stamp: htk31_f769b577b3028a4e9958e5bb8d1259a

- [ ] Before the Quillhaven signing ceremony proceeds, run the leaked-file-descriptor hunt on the offline signer. As a new contractor, please be thorough: enumerate every open descriptor on the sealed host, confirm nothing points at the ceremony scratch volume, and log each finding in the Larkspur register. If any descriptor traces back to the retired Fenwick exporter, halt and page the ceremony lead. Once the host shows a clean descriptor table, unlock the escrow envelope using the phrase below.

unlock words, yajof-tagef: aldiel-kasath-briax-fraeth-pelius-olieth-pelix-wenius-wenael-norael

**Ticket: Intermittent connection failures in Ledgerline ORM refactor**

While migrating the legacy Ledgerline ORM layer to the new repository pattern, the staging service drops connections under load. We suspect the old pool settings are carried over from the deprecated adapter. New team members reproducing this should configure the refactored adapter with the staging database connection string below.

warehouse DSN: mssql://rusdor_svc:0FSWCn9@db-951a.paliqforge.local:5432/ulawyn